Advantages of the EB-5 Visa Program

  • • The EB-5 Visa (Investment Green Card) allows you and your family to live, work or retire anywhere within the United States.
  • • No Quota Backlogs. There are many delays and backlogs for employment and family based green card categories, but there is no backlog for the EB-5 Investor Visa category.
  • • No Sponsor Needed. Foreign investors use their own personal funds and do not require sponsorship from either an employer or a family member.
  • • Regional Center Investment Programs. Many of the approved EB-5 regional centers allow foreign investors to invest in prearranged programs for only $900,000 plus administrative fees.
  • • Permanent Residency. Foreign investors may enter a limited partnership with few or no day-to-day management responsibilities for their investment program. This allows foreign investors to live and work in the United States in any capacity.

Eligibility Criteria for Permanent Residence

You may be eligible to receive EB-5 permanent residence based on investment if:

  • • You have an approved Form I-526, Immigrant Petition by Alien Entrepreneur;
  • • You are admissible to the United States; and
  • • An immigrant visa is immediately available.
